Revolutionising Sustainable Driving: The Role of Connected Vehicle Technology in Modern EVs

In an era marked by pressing climate imperatives and rapid technological advancement, the automotive industry stands at a pivotal crossroads. Electric vehicles (EVs) have shifted from niche alternatives to mainstream contenders, driven by consumer demand, policy incentives, and technological innovation. But to truly unlock the potential of EVs, automakers are increasingly integrating advanced digital connectivity, transforming cars from simple transport devices into sophisticated, data-driven mobility platforms.

The Evolution of Vehicle Connectivity: From Basic Features to Integrated Ecosystems

Historically, vehicle connectivity was limited to basic features such as Bluetooth and Bluetooth-enabled infotainment systems. Today, the landscape has evolved into comprehensive digital ecosystems that enhance driver experience, safety, and efficiency. Modern EVs now incorporate V2X (vehicle-to-everything) communication, real-time navigation analytics, predictive maintenance, and more, all accessed through dedicated mobile applications.

According to industry reports from McKinsey & Company, the global connected car market is projected to reach USD 225 billion by 2025, reflecting both the consumer appetite and automaker investment in digital services. This shift underscores a fundamental transformation—vehicles are no longer mere mechanical machines but integrated digital platforms that communicate, learn, and adapt.

Why Digital Ecosystems Matter for Electric Vehicles

Benefit Impact
Enhanced User Experience Personalised controls, remote diagnostics, and seamless integration boost driver satisfaction
Operational Efficiency Real-time data optimizes charging, route planning, and energy management, extending battery life
Improved Safety V2X communication reduces accidents through hazard alerts and vehicle coordination
Sustainable Mobility Informed charging decisions and route optimisation lower emissions and energy waste

Industry Insights: The Future of Connected EVs

Industry analysts forecast that by 2030, nearly 80% of new EVs will incorporate advanced connected features, shaping a landscape where vehicles function as dynamic, interconnected entities. Such a shift demands stringent standards around cybersecurity and data privacy, fostering collaborations between automakers, tech firms, and regulatory bodies.
